<p>Catholic High School meets Coral Secondary School in the 3rd and 4th placing match today. Coral Secondary School had lost their semi-final game against Northland Secondary School a day ago but they were still gunning to win this match to clinch the bronze medal. Catholic High School, who lost their quarter-final match against Coral Secondary School, will look to make amends by beating them today as well. Both teams were highly motivated to do well for this match but unfortunately, there can only be one winner.</p>
<p>It did not take long for the scoring to start. Hao Yuan broke the deadlock in just 4 minutes with a well taken goal but Coral Secondary School replied almost immediately with the equaliser. Selwin restored the lead with a penalty in the 10th minute and Catholic High School goes into the break with the advantage.</p>
<p>National Inter-School Floorball Championships 2011 (&#8216;C&#8217; Division)<br />
Coral Secondary School vs Catholic High School<br />
Republic Polytechnic<br />
5-3 (1-2, 2-0, 2-1)</p>
<p>It all fell apart for Catholic High School in the second period as two defensive lapses saw the opponents put in two goals in the space of 2 minutes. The players tried to fight back to no avail and the period ended with the score of 3-2.</p>

<p>Both teams head into the final period determined to secure their advantage, and it was the opponents who did so once again with another two quick goals after 5 minutes. Jeremiah could only score a late consolation goal as the match ended with Coral Secondary School victorious.</p>
<p>The season has ended for the team. Although much was expected of the players, it was a great achievement to have qualified for the semi-final. Many players have improved over the course of the season and they must continue to do so to sustain their level of play in the years to come.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>In the last quarter-final game, even though both teams had qualified for the semi-final, the players were all gunning for another victory to add to their records. Under the good guidance of the coach and teachers in Coral Secondary School, the team has as good a record as Catholic High School, winning all their games before today. This match will decide the group winner and runner-up before the semi-final on Wednesday.</p>
<p>National Inter-School Floorball Championships 2011 (&#8216;C&#8217; Division)<br />
Catholic High School vs Coral Secondary School<br />
Republic Polytechnic<br />
4-7 (0-3, 1-2, 3-2)</p>
<p>Coral Secondary School took the lead within 2 minutes when their forward took a speculative shot from half court. Jing Zhou was slow to react and the ball bounced into the net. A free hit given 4 minutes later saw the players in dreamland while the forward took a direct shot into the top corner of the goal. Now trailing by 2 goals, the situation was further compounded when a sudden long shot landed in front of the goalkeeper and bounced awkwardly over and into the goal. Despite the unlucky nature of the goals, the players had to take the blame for allowing the opponents time and space to shoot. It was a poor performance by the team by anybody&#8217;s standard.</p>
<p>This continued in the second period, even when Donovan scored his debut goal of the season. Lapses in the defence in the final 5 minutes allowed the opponents to scored 2 goals. With a 4 goal deficit, it was increasingly difficult for the team to comeback.</p>
<p>However, all was not over as the players picked themselves up in the third period. Han Keong and Donovan combined to score two quick goals, but individual errors from the defenders let the team down again as Coral Secondary School returned with two goals of their own. Selwin managed to score with 2 minutes remaining, but it was too late for any fight back as the team suffered their first loss of the season.</p>
<p>In a tight game, errors as such will prove to be decisive. The players must learn from this harsh but timely lesson, and recover quickly for Wednesday, as they will meet Victoria School in the semi-final match. This game will be a true test of the team&#8217;s character and mental strength.</p>
